Very fine Mica powders can be used by mixing powders with Klyer Fire into a very thin consistancy. Then adding (less painting than dropping and moving droplets to fill area) All of this has to thoroughly dry and then cap with compatible (to base) glass on top. Remember that Mica is a mineral and therefore will not melt, so the cap has to have a border around it with no Mica coverage. After drying, Mica can also be scratched off to form designs.
